I should start asking my new customers, who say my reviews got them to call, about their review site perusing habits..
How about you all, when vetting a restaurant or proctologist, how many reviews do you read?
Are pictures important?
Do you read the 1 stars first? I do, when I'm using Amazon and researching products I notice the 1s tend to come from people who've had the product for a while. The 5s tend to come from people who just opened the box.
So with service reviews I would think that those that mention a history of prior use with the company hold more weight than the solicited "John showed up on time, is personable and the carpets look just like new"
